2009 has been a year of learning and consolidation for the Millennia Institute hockey team. This journey has focused not just on developing the students’ skills and performance on the hockey pitch, but also on capability building.
Highlights of the year not only included the solid matches played, but also other learning points gained from teamwork. Numerous friendly matches and hockey carnivals became platforms for our players to hone their skills and game proficiency. In line with our aim to nurture our players in off-pitch competencies as well, they were also given the chance to lead and organise school-related events such as CCA Open House, Hockey Trials and the Day Camp held in March. Other related courses included Level 1 Hockey Umpiring Course and the First Aid Course. Students who showed potential were also selected for the Talent Management Programme. In addition, some of our students were also chosen to represent the national age-group teams and had the opportunity to train with the national team. Some have gone on to represent club sides in the local leagues as well. The teams were also involved in several projects that not only solidified their sense of camaraderie and spirit of community service, but also heightened awareness of the scientific research done in their sport, which enhanced their general knowledge.
